1. click "customer service" (upper right hand corner of screen). 2. on customer service screen, click on "self service" tab, second from left. 3. scroll down to "reinvest your dividends" (DRIP), and click. 4. it will prompt you for which account and holding you want to reinvest/stop reinvesting dividends for.

Two of the most common measures to determine a mutual fund’s risk versus return level are its standard deviation and Sharpe Ratio. 1. Standard deviation shows the consistency of a mutual fund’s returns over time. A high standard deviation means that the fund’s returns significantly swing above or below the average. Mutual funds make for a simple and efficient way to diversify ...Jul 31, 2023 · Offering more than 4,000 no-transaction fee mutual funds, E*TRADE is an excellent broker fo mutual funds since it's easy to avoid trading fees that many other brokers charge. But be aware that they do impose an early redemption fee of $49.99 if you buy no-transaction fee funds then sell them within 90 days.

All things finance, …Mutual funds are not traded freely on the open market as stocks and ETFs are. Nevertheless, they are easy to purchase directly from the financial company that manages the fund. They also can be ...But with mutual funds, you own the underlying assets and have to pay tax on the trades made within the funds. So, if a fund manager sells an asset in the fund, you may have to pay a hefty short-term capital gains tax at the end of the year. Related: ETFs vs. mutual funds. A mutual fund is a company that pools money from many investors and invests the money in securities such as stocks, bonds, and short-term debt. The combined holdings of the mutual fund are known as its portfolio. Investors buy shares in mutual funds.
